About this scheme

The Phase 1 Public Sector Low Carbon Skills Fund was launched on behalf of Department for Energy Security and Net Zero (formerly the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y) in September 2020 to help all eligible public sector bodies to engage specialist and expert advice to identify and develop energy efficiency and low carbon heat upgrade projects for non-domestic buildings and then prepare robust and effective applications for the £1bn Public Sector Decarbonisation Scheme. The scheme ran until 31 March 2021.

Scheme benefits

  • The scheme provided up to £32m of grant funding to help public sector bodies to access the Public Sector Decarbonisation Scheme.
  • Provided funding for project development, project delivery and heat decarbonisation plan support.
  • Allowed public sector bodies to engage specialist and expert advice to identify and develop energy efficiency and low carbon heat upgrade projects.
  • Successful applicants were able to use their project delivery and heat decarbonisation plans to apply for the Public Sector Decarbonisation Scheme.
